What is meant by  traditional thesaurus?

Dictionary entries for synonyms date back a long time. Peter Mark Roget first referred to his Roget's Thesaurus as a "thesaurus" in 1852.

While some "thesauri," like Roget's Thesaurus, arrange words according to a hierarchical hypernymic taxonomy of concepts, other thesauri or other collections are arranged alphabetically.

Some thesauri and dictionary synonym notes explain the differences between related words by providing information on their "connotations and varying shades of meaning.

Differentiating synonyms based on their usage and meaning is a major focus of several synonym dictionaries. Synonyms are frequently used correctly according to usage manuals like Fowler's Dictionary of Modern English Usage and Garner's Modern English Usage.

What is the zoo of death and what are its levels?

Answers

In the book The Princess Bride written by: William Goldman. Their is a Zoo of Death with five levels of pure torture not to mention horror for those who enter. Made by Prince Humperdinck. The zoo was an underground dungeon. Located on the grounds of the castle in a remote area.

The first level:
Contained various creatures of speed. Wild dogs humming birds and cheetahs would be located here.

The second level:
 Creatures of immense strength. rhino's, anacondas, and crocodiles would be contained in this level.

The third level:
 Poisonous animals lurked about. This is where spitting cobras, death bats and jumping spiders were located.

The fourth level:
 Enemies of fear were contained in this level. Sucking squid, blood eagle and the shrieking tarantula tormented those in the fourth level.

The fifth level:
 Was left completely empty. The prince was hoping to put a creature as deadly as himself in this level.
 Later it contained Westley and the machine.

Which one of the following sentences best explains the term bias?a. Bias is an opinion that favors one point of view.
b. Bias exchanges a negative opinion for a positive one.
c. Bias is a negative opinion.
d. Bias is an interpretation of something

Answers

The correct answer is: a. Bias is an opinion that favors one point of view.

When a theorist or researcher displays bias in her/her work, he/she favors one point of view, while disregarding other points of view that might be valid and relevant. An example of a bias would be when a scientist claims that caffeine alone increases energy levels, while ignoring the effect of other significant factors, such adequate sleep, carbohydrates, etc., on energy levels. In this instance, the scientists is favoring one point of view, while dismissing other factors that are also relevant to the issue at hand.

A. Bias is an opinion that favors one point of view. Bias is an inclination or outlook to present or hold a partial perspective, often accompanied by a refusal to consider the possible merits of alternative points of view.
